| /* parsing.c: parsing of config files
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Copyright (C) 2006-2014 cgit Development Team <cgit@lists.zx2c4.com>
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Licensed under GNU General Public License v2
 | |
|  *   (see COPYING for full license text)
 | |
|  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| #include "cgit.h"
 | |
| 
 | |
| /*
 | |
|  * url syntax: [repo ['/' cmd [ '/' path]]]
 | |
|  *   repo: any valid repo url, may contain '/'
 | |
|  *   cmd:  log | commit | diff | tree | view | blob | snapshot
 | |
|  *   path: any valid path, may contain '/'
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  */
 | |
| void cgit_parse_url(const char *url)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	char *c, *cmd, *p;
 | |
| 	struct cgit_repo *repo;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!url || url[0] == '\0')
 | |
| 		return;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	ctx.qry.page = NULL;
 | |
| 	ctx.repo = cgit_get_repoinfo(url);
 | |
| 	if (ctx.repo) {
 | |
| 		ctx.qry.repo = ctx.repo->url;
 | |
| 		return;
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	cmd = NULL;
 | |
| 	c = strchr(url, '/');
 | |
| 	while (c) {
 | |
| 		c[0] = '\0';
 | |
| 		repo = cgit_get_repoinfo(url);
 | |
| 		if (repo) {
 | |
| 			ctx.repo = repo;
 | |
| 			cmd = c;
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 		c[0] = '/';
 | |
| 		c = strchr(c + 1, '/');
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(ctx.repo) {
 | |
| 		ctx.qry.repo = ctx.repo->url;
 | |
| 		p = strchr(cmd + 1, '/');
 | |
| 		if (p) {
 | |
| 			p[0] = '\0';
 | |
| 			if (p[1])
 | |
| 				ctx.qry.path = trim_end(p + 1, '/');
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 		if (cmd[1])
 | |
| 			ctx.qry.page = xstrdup(cmd + 1);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static char *substr(const char *head, const char *tail)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	char *buf;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(tail < head)
 | |
| 		return xstrdup("");
 | |
| 	buf = xmalloc(tail - head + 1);
 | |
| 	strlcpy(buf, head, tail - head + 1);
 | |
| 	return buf;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static void parse_user(const char *t, char **name, char **email, unsigned long *date, int *tz)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	struct ident_split ident;
 | |
| 	unsigned email_len;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!split_ident_line(&ident, t, strchrnul(t, '\n') - t)) {
 | |
| 		*name = substr(ident.name_begin, ident.name_end);
 | |
| 
 | |
| 		email_len = ident.mail_end - ident.mail_begin;
 | |
| 		*email = xmalloc(strlen("<") + email_len + strlen(">") + 1);
 | |
| 		xsnprintf(*email, email_len + 3, "<%.*s>", email_len, ident.mail_begin);
 | |
| 
 | |
| 		if (ident.date_begin)
 | |
| 			*date = strtoul(ident.date_begin, NULL, 10);
 | |
| 		if (ident.tz_begin)
 | |
| 			*tz = atoi(ident.tz_begin);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| #ifdef NO_ICONV
 | |
| #define reencode(a, b, c)
 | |
| #else
 | |
| static const char *reencode(char **txt, const char *src_enc, const char *dst_enc)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	char *tmp;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!txt)
 | |
| 		return NULL;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!*txt || !src_enc || !dst_enc)
 | |
| 		return *txt;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	/* no encoding needed if src_enc equals dst_enc */
 | |
| 	if (!strcasecmp(src_enc, dst_enc))
 | |
| 		return *txt;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	tmp = reencode_string(*txt, dst_enc, src_enc);
 | |
| 	if (tmp) {
 | |
| 		free(*txt);
 | |
| 		*txt = tmp;
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 	return *txt;
 | |
| }
 | |
| #endif
 | |
| 
 | |
| static const char *next_header_line(const char *p)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	p = strchr(p, '\n');
 | |
| 	if (!p)
 | |
| 		return NULL;
 | |
| 	return p + 1;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| static int end_of_header(const char *p)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	return !p || (*p == '\n');
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| struct commitinfo *cgit_parse_commit(struct commit *commit)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	const int sha1hex_len = 40;
 | |
| 	struct commitinfo *ret;
 | |
| 	const char *p = get_cached_commit_buffer(the_repository, commit, NULL);
 | |
| 	const char *t;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	ret = xcalloc(1, sizeof(struct commitinfo));
 | |
| 	ret->commit = commit;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!p)
 | |
| 		return ret;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!skip_prefix(p, "tree ", &p))
 | |
| 		die("Bad commit: %s", oid_to_hex(&commit->object.oid));
 | |
| 	p += sha1hex_len + 1;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	while (skip_prefix(p, "parent ", &p))
 | |
| 		p += sha1hex_len + 1;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(p && skip_prefix(p, "author ", &p)) {
 | |
| 		parse_user(p, &ret->author, &ret->author_email,
 | |
| 			&ret->author_date, &ret->author_tz);
 | |
| 		p = next_header_line(p);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(p && skip_prefix(p, "committer ", &p)) {
 | |
| 		parse_user(p, &ret->committer, &ret->committer_email,
 | |
| 			&ret->committer_date, &ret->committer_tz);
 | |
| 		p = next_header_line(p);
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(p && skip_prefix(p, "encoding ", &p)) {
 | |
| 		t = strchr(p, '\n');
 | |
| 		if (t) {
 | |
| 			ret->msg_encoding = substr(p, t + 1);
 | |
| 			p = t + 1;
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(!ret->msg_encoding)
 | |
| 		ret->msg_encoding = xstrdup("UTF-8");
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	while (!end_of_header(p))
 | |
| 		p = next_header_line(p);
 | |
| 	while (p && *p == '\n')
 | |
| 		p++;
 | |
| 	if (!p)
 | |
| 		return ret;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	t = strchrnul(p, '\n');
 | |
| 	ret->subject = substr(p, t);
 | |
| 	while (*t == '\n')
 | |
| 		t++;
 | |
| 	ret->msg = xstrdup(t);
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	reencode(&ret->author, ret->msg_encoding, PAGE_ENCODING);
 | |
| 	reencode(&ret->author_email, ret->msg_encoding, PAGE_ENCODING);
 | |
| 	reencode(&ret->committer, ret->msg_encoding, PAGE_ENCODING);
 | |
| 	reencode(&ret->committer_email, ret->msg_encoding, PAGE_ENCODING);
 | |
| 	reencode(&ret->subject, ret->msg_encoding, PAGE_ENCODING);
 | |
| 	reencode(&ret->msg, ret->msg_encoding, PAGE_ENCODING);
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return ret;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| struct taginfo *cgit_parse_tag(struct tag *tag)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	void *data;
 | |
| 	enum object_type type;
 | |
| 	unsigned long size;
 | |
| 	const char *p;
 | |
| 	struct taginfo *ret = NULL;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	data = read_object_file(&tag->object.oid, &type, &size);
 | |
| 	if (!data || type != OBJ_TAG)
 | |
| 		goto cleanup;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	ret = xcalloc(1, sizeof(struct taginfo));
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for (p = data; !end_of_header(p); p = next_header_line(p)) {
 | |
| 		if (skip_prefix(p, "tagger ", &p)) {
 | |
| 			parse_user(p, &ret->tagger, &ret->tagger_email,
 | |
| 				&ret->tagger_date, &ret->tagger_tz);
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	while (p && *p == '\n')
 | |
| 		p++;
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	if (p && *p)
 | |
| 		ret->msg = xstrdup(p);
 | |
| 
 | |
| cleanup:
 | |
| 	free(data);
 | |
| 	return ret;
 | |
| }
